POLYMORPHISM OF KRT1.2 AND KAP1.3 GENES IN INDIAN SHEEP BREEDS

摘要

Keratin proteins are the major components of sheep wool, which are divided into two major groups: keratin intermediate filament (KIF) proteins and keratin-associated proteins (KAP). In this study, polymerase chain reaction-restriction fragment lengthpolymorphism (PCR-RFLP) was used to study the genotype and allele frequencies of KRT1.2 and KAP 1.3 genes in the major wool sheep breeds/strains of India viz., Malpura, Avikalin, Chokla, Sonadi, Nali, Nellore, Garole, Magra, Deccani, Patanwadi and Kendrapara. M alleles predominated in KRT 1.2 locus; while variations in predominance between allele X and allele Y at KAP 1.3 locus were observed in the studied populations. All three genotypes were observed in native sheep populations for KRT 1.2 and KAP 1.3loci.
